BUCKLING OF CORE-STABILIZED CYLINDERS UNDER AXIALLY-SYMMETRICAL EXTERNAL LOADS,

Abstract

An equation is derived for the elastic stability of a circular cylindrical shell which is filled with a soft elastic core and is subjected to general axiallysymmetrical lateral pressure combined with a central axial force. Numerical results are given for three lateral pressure distributions of interest in rocket motor case analysis: Uniform pressure, linearly varying pressure, and a circumferential band of pressure located at an arbitrary distance from one end of the cylinder. Comparison is made with results of previous theoretical and experimental investigations, where available. (Author)
